# MATCH () with multiple conditions (mb VBA needed)

• Seems, needs universal macro, or the optimal formula "MATCH ()" for big data

PS: That formula in the file

=INDEX(\$A\$1:\$K\$9,MATCH(LARGE(IF((\$B\$1:\$B\$9=\$B2)*(\$D\$1:\$D\$9<>"Type 1"),\$K\$1:\$K\$9),1),\$K\$1:\$K\$9,0),COLUMN())
well for small tables. But if table have thousands rows - very long time waiting.

• Result will be one only.
If cell in "C" column (for "Type 1" only in "D" column) completely coincides with value from other range of column D, then copy/paste the values in the corresponding cells. Sry my English.

Example. C2 and C7 have in column "D" value "Type 1". So E2:J2 and E7:J7 need formula.
C2=C10. С2=С9. It is necessary to choose from the found coincidence only with biggest value in a column K

Row for value C9 in K9>than K10 in in the found coincidence C10.
So E2=E9. F2=F9... till J2=J9.